id Software co-founder John Carmack believes the next hardware cycle will begin “earlier rather than later” and that it will be Sony who gets to the market first.

“The whole jockeying for who's going to release the first next-gen console is very interesting and pretty divorced from the technical side of things,” Carmack told CD-Action.

“Whether Sony wants to jump the gun to prevent the same sort of 360 lag from happening to them again seems likely.

“As developers, we would really like to see this generation stretch as long as possible. We'd like to see it be quite a few more years before the next-gen consoles comes out, but I suspect one will end up shipping something earlier rather than later.”

Carmack also chipped in on the debate over digital distribution, revealing that he believes one of the consoles in the next generation will ship without the capacity for optical media.

“I think there's a decent chance that one of the next-gen consoles will be without optical media,” said Carmack. “The uptake rates of people who have broadband connects surprised everyone this generation. It's higher than what the core publishers and even the first party people expected.”
